Getting Virtual Networks

This section explains how to get a list of virtual networks.

Request

GET https://<hostname>/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ks

Request Headers

The request header must contain an authorization token of the current session.

Request Parameters

None.

Request Body

None.

Response

The server returns the following response to the client.

Response Codes

A successfully completed operation returns a response code 200 (OK).

Response Headers

The response to this request contains the following headers. The response may also include additional standard HTTPS headers.

Header

Description

Content-length

The length of the response body.

Content-type

The media type and syntax of the response body message: application/json; charset=utf-8

Response Body

Property

Type

Description

offset

integer

Shows the offset value.

limit

integer

Shows the offset limit.

totalCount

integer

Shows the number of records in the results array.

results

Results Object

Contains the result object.

_links

Dictionary of string [key] and Object [value]

Links to related resources (navigation property).

Results Object

Property

Type

Description

id

string

Shows the identification number of the virtual network.

name

string

Shows the name of the network.

regionName

string

Shows the name of the region to which the network belongs.

addressSpaces

string

Shows the address space of the virtual network.

_links

Dictionary of string [key] and Object [value]

Links to related resources (navigation property).

Example

Request:

GET https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ks

 

Request Header:

Authorization: Bearer <Access-Token>

 

Response:

200 OK

 

Response Body:

{

  "offset": 0,

  "limit": 30,

  "totalCount": 229,

  "results":    [

           {

        "id": "/subscriptions/3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809/resourcegroups/aamaltsev/providers/microsoft.network/virtualnetworks/vba_vnet-australiaeast-0",

        "name": "VBA_VNET-australiaeast-0",

        "regionName": "australiaeast",

        "addressSpaces": ["10.130.0.0/16"],

        "_links":          {

           "subscription":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/subscriptions/3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809"},

           "self":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ks/%2Fsubscriptions%2F3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809%2Fresourcegroups%2Faamaltsev%2Fproviders%2Fmicrosoft.network%2Fvirtualnetworks%2Fvba_vnet-australiaeast-0"}

        }

     },

           {

        "id": "/subscriptions/3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809/resourcegroups/cpm-backup-martin/providers/microsoft.network/virtualnetworks/cpmbackupmartinvnet592",

        "name": "cpmbackupmartinvnet592",

        "regionName": "australiaeast",

        "addressSpaces": ["10.4.63.0/24"],

        "_links":          {

           "subscription":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/subscriptions/3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809"},

           "self":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ks/%2Fsubscriptions%2F3a9a8330-7bbc-4b03-9c68-15d674fbc809%2Fresourcegroups%2Fcpm-backup-martin%2Fproviders%2Fmicrosoft.network%2Fvirtualnetworks%2Fcpmbackupmartinvnet592"}

        }

     }

  ],

  "_links":    {

     "self":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com:443/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ks?offset=0&limit=30"},

     "next": {"href": "https://abc.ukwest.cloudapp.azure.com:443/api/v1/cloudInfrastructure/virtualNetworks?offset=30&limit=30"}

  }

}
